  • In the event of ship to ship (“STS”) operation undertaken at the request of Buyer, all time used in connection with STS operations (such time shall commence 6 hours after NOR has been tendered or when the Vessel is moored to the STS Vessel, whichever is earlier and shall end when the Vessel is unmoored from the last Cargo receiving Vessel) shall count as used laytime, or, if the Vessel is on demurrage, as time on demurrage all time to count weather permitting OR not.

  • MARPOL Annex I Chapter 8, Regulation 40 (5) provides: “The regulations contained in this chapter shall not apply to STS operations where either of the ships involved is a warship, naval auxiliary or other ship owned or operated by a State and used, for the time being, only on government non-commercial service.
